Something strange hits a small-town neighborhood in the first Ghostbusters: Afterlife trailer. 

Mysterious earthquakes rock a rural Oklahoma community. Green beams of light emanate from craters and caves. Explosions smash windows and cars. What is the cause of all this? Could it be ghosts? Well… who ya’ gonna call?!

Ghostbusters: Afterlife will star Stranger Things actor Finn Wolfhard, as well as Paul Rudd, McKenna Grace, and Carrie Coon. Fans of the original Ghostbusters film will be excited to hear that beloved cast members Bill Murray, Dan Aykroyd, Ernie Hudson, and Sigourney Weaver are expected to reprise their roles. 

Judging by the trailer, Ghostbusters: Afterlife will be more dark and serious than its goofy, whimsical original. Director Jason Reitman — son of Ivan Reitman, who directed Ghostbusters in 1984 — is on board to direct the new movie. Ivan Reitman will act as producer for his son’s take on the Ghostbusters brand. 

Ghostbusters: Afterlife will hit theaters next July. Check out the trailer below.
